 BBC News had a report on this - last night. Apparently a cameraman on the show had developed a  type of fish-eye lens which was used in the David Bowie clip. He kept the tape as demonstration of the the new lens. He is supposed to have 100 Quad tapes which he kept as demonstrations of the lens and some of these may be "lost" also.

Attention David Bowie fans!

A recently rediscovered David Bowie Top of the Pops performance has been shown on television for the first time since it was originally broadcast in 1973. What appears to be a 2" quad reel is shown during the interview segment.

It was believed that every recording of the singer performing Jean Genie had been destroyed.
